So, I decided to take this idea and tweak it a bit to create a love note area in our home right as you head out the door. That way before he heads to work he can see how much I love him and appreciate him as a father and as a husband. I don’t know about you but I just don’t tell my husband that enough.
It’s an EASY and quick gift to make and can easily be done on a budget. I grabbed some already painted frames but you can use any frame and change the color if you prefer- these just so happened to be 50% off at Hobby Lobby and were just the color I needed.
Then I cut out the right size of paper. Note: I stuck with a simple light pattern so the words would not get lost when I wrote my message.
Then, I found this Valentines vinyl for 50% off at Craft Warehouse and decided to add that to the top. Note: you can just print the words on the printer- but I was too scared to mess it up with my temperamental printer. :/
Add some black lettering to complete the phrase “I love you because” and you are almost done!
Then I couldn’t resist using mustaches and red lips to create a memo board to add extra little reminders. Also, I forgot to mention that I took the liberty to make one for myself so he can shower me with love notes as well. 😉
